4. Setup and Assembly

The puller can be configured with either two or three jaws depending on the application and the component being removed.

4.1. Selecting Jaw Configuration

  • Two-Jaw Configuration: Suitable for diagonal pulling of smaller bearings or components where space is limited. Provides quick setup.
  • Three-Jaw Configuration: Recommended for larger components, providing a stable triangular grip for secure and even pulling force.

4.2. Attaching Jaws

  1. Select the desired number of jaws (two or three).
  2. Align the holes on the jaws with the corresponding holes on the puller's main body.
  3. Securely fasten each jaw using the provided high-strength bolts. Ensure all bolts are tightened evenly and firmly.

5. Operating Instructions

Follow these steps for safe and effective operation of the hydraulic bearing puller.

5.1. Preparation

  • Ensure the workpiece is clean and free of debris.
  • Verify that the oil return switch on the hydraulic cylinder is in the 'OFF' (closed) position before applying pressure.

5.2. Positioning the Puller

  1. Place the puller jaws around the component to be removed, ensuring a firm and even grip.
  2. Center the puller's ram against the shaft or center point of the component.
  3. The puller can be operated in both vertical and horizontal orientations, allowing flexible gripping in various positions.

5.3. Applying Hydraulic Force

  1. Once the puller is securely positioned, insert the operating handle into the pump body.
  2. Pump the handle slowly and steadily to extend the hydraulic ram. Observe the component for movement.
  3. Continue pumping until the component is safely removed. Avoid rapid or jerky movements.

5.4. Releasing Pressure

  1. Once the component is removed, slowly turn the oil return switch to the 'ON' (open) position.
  2. The hydraulic ram will retract, releasing the pressure.
  3. Remove the puller from the workpiece.

6. Maintenance

Regular maintenance ensures the longevity and reliable performance of your hydraulic puller.

  • Cleaning: After each use, wipe down the puller with a clean cloth to remove dirt, grease, and debris.
  • Lubrication: Periodically apply a light coat of machine oil to moving parts and threads to prevent rust and ensure smooth operation.
  • Inspection: Regularly check for signs of wear, cracks, or damage to the jaws, bolts, hydraulic cylinder, and seals.
  • Hydraulic Fluid: While the system is self-contained, monitor for any signs of hydraulic fluid leaks. If a leak is detected, discontinue use and seek professional repair.
  • Storage: Store the puller in its original carrying case in a dry, cool place to protect it from environmental elements.

7. Troubleshooting

If you encounter issues with your hydraulic bearing puller, refer to the following common problems and solutions:

  • Puller Not Generating Force:
    • Ensure the oil return switch is fully closed ('OFF' position).
    • Check for hydraulic fluid leaks.
    • Verify that the jaws are securely gripping the component.
  • Ram Not Retracting:
    • Ensure the oil return switch is fully open ('ON' position).
    • Check for any mechanical obstructions.
  • Jaws Slipping:
    • Ensure the jaws are properly seated and gripping the component firmly.
    • Consider using the three-jaw configuration for a more stable grip if currently using two jaws.
    • Clean any grease or oil from the gripping surfaces of the jaws and the component.
